DOCKER(1)		      Docker User Manuals		     DOCKER(1)



NAME
       docker - Docker image and container command line interface



SYNOPSIS
       docker [OPTIONS] COMMAND [ARG...]


       docker [--help|-v|--version]



DESCRIPTION
       docker is a client for interacting with the daemon (see dockerd(8))
       through the CLI.


       The Docker CLI has over 30 commands. The commands are listed below and
       each has its own man page which explains usage and arguments.


       To see the man page for a command run man docker .



OPTIONS
       --help
	 Print usage statement


       --config=""
	 Specifies the location of the Docker client configuration files. The
       default is '~/.docker'.


       -D, --debug=true|false
	 Enable debug mode. Default is false.


       -H, --host=[unix:///var/run/docker.sock]: tcp://[host]:[port][path] to
       bind or unix://[/path/to/socket] to use.
	 The socket(s) to bind to in daemon mode specified using one or more
	 tcp://host:port/path, unix:///path/to/socket, fd://* or
       fd://socketfd.
	 If the tcp port is not specified, then it will default to either 2375
       when
	 --tls is off, or 2376 when --tls is on, or --tlsverify is specified.


       -l, --log-level="debug|info|warn|error|fatal"
	 Set the logging level. Default is info.


       --tls=true|false
	 Use TLS; implied by --tlsverify. Default is false.


       --tlscacert=~/.docker/ca.pem
	 Trust certs signed only by this CA.


       --tlscert=~/.docker/cert.pem
	 Path to TLS certificate file.


       --tlskey=~/.docker/key.pem
	 Path to TLS key file.


       --tlsverify=true|false
	 Use TLS and verify the remote (daemon: verify client, client: verify
       daemon).
	 Default is false.


       -v, --version=true|false
	 Print version information and quit. Default is false.



COMMANDS
       Use "docker help" or "docker --help" to get an overview of available
       commands.



EXAMPLES
       For specific client examples see the man page for the specific Docker
       command. For example:

       man docker-run
